Meaning and Usage
The Ghost Emoji has multiple interpretations and is utilized in diverse contexts. Here are some common meanings associated with this emoji:
- Fear or Spookiness: The Ghost Emoji is often employed to depict fear, horror, or something spooky. It can be used in relation to Halloween, ghost stories, or any eerie situation.
- Cuteness or Playfulness: Despite its ghostly appearance, the Ghost Emoji is also used to convey a sense of cuteness, playfulness, or whimsy. It can be utilized to express lightheartedness or as a friendly way to represent ghosts.
- Invisibility or Disappearance: The transparent nature of a ghost is sometimes associated with the concept of invisibility or disappearance. The Ghost Emoji can be used to imply disappearing or going unnoticed.
- Internet Slang: In certain online communities, the Ghost Emoji has acquired additional meanings. It is sometimes used to refer to someone who lurks or observes a conversation without actively participating, similar to a ghost silently present.
- Spirituality or Supernatural: The Ghost Emoji may also be used in discussions related to the supernatural, paranormal, or spiritual topics. It can symbolize the presence of spirits or otherworldly phenomena.
- Death or Mourning: Occasionally, the Ghost Emoji is used to express grief, mourning, or remembrance of someone who has passed away.
- Sarcasm or Irony: Like many other emojis, the Ghost Emoji can be used sarcastically or ironically, depending on the context and tone of the conversation.

History and Approval
The Ghost Emoji was first introduced as part of the Unicode 6.0 standard in 2010. It gained popularity quickly and became widely adopted across various digital platforms and social media networks. The emoji's appearance varies slightly between different platforms, but it generally depicts a white ghost with black eyes and a friendly expression.

Unicode and Shortcodes Details
The Unicode representation of the Ghost Emoji is U+1F47B. It can be encoded and displayed across different platforms and applications using this codepoint. Some commonly used shortcodes for the Ghost Emoji include :ghost: and :booo:.

Usage of U+1F47B Emoji in Various Programming Languages
Programming Language | Code Snippet |
---|---|
Python | print("\U0001F47B") |
Java | System.out.println("\uD83D\uDC7B"); |
C++ | std::cout << "\U0001F47B"; |
JavaScript | console.log("\uD83D\uDC7B"); |
Ruby | puts "\u{1F47B}" |
PHP | echo "\u{1F47B}"; |
Swift | print("\u{1F47B}") |
C# | Console.WriteLine("\U0001F47B"); |
Go | fmt.Println("\U0001F47B") |
Rust | println!("\u{1F47B}") |
